Tactical Evolution and the Post-World Cup Roster Reset

Entering the 2026/27 campaign, the North London side continues to evolve under the long-term project led by Mikel Arteta and Edu Gaspar. The fixture list provides no room for a "World Cup hangover," as the Gunners face three of the traditional "Big Six" within the first five matches of the season. This dense scheduling requires immediate physical peak performance from key players like Bukayo Saka and Martin Ødegaard, who remain the heartbeat of the midfield transition.

Tactical analysts are closely watching how the Arsenal fixtures intersect with the newly expanded UEFA Champions League format. With the "League Phase" now demanding more high-intensity matches early in the autumn, squad rotation will be the primary theme of August and September. The club’s recent investments in defensive depth and a high-profile striking addition during the July window suggest they are prepared for the multi-front assault on domestic and European silverware.

The North London Derby on September 12 remains the most anticipated date for the local faithful. Coming immediately after the first international break of the season, this fixture historically sets the tone for the autumn months. Success in these early "six-pointer" matches against Liverpool and Manchester City will be essential if Arsenal hopes to avoid the mid-season fatigue that has hampered previous title charges.

Watching the Gunners: Global Streaming and Emirates Access

As the global demand for Arsenal tickets reaches an all-time high, the club has implemented a more robust ballot system for Red and Silver members. For those unable to attend the Emirates Stadium in person, the 2026 broadcast landscape offers more flexibility than ever before. In the United Kingdom, the primary rights remain split between Sky Sports and TNT Sports, with several "Big Match" packages also available via dedicated streaming platforms that have replaced traditional cable models this year.

International supporters, particularly those in the United States and Asia, can access every minute of the Arsenal fixtures through high-definition streaming services. Most 3:00 PM Saturday fixtures—traditionally blacked out in the UK—are available for international fans via licensed Premier League partners. The club's official app also provides "Match Day Live" audio commentary and real-time statistical overlays, catering to a digital-first audience that demands deeper tactical insights during live play.

The 2026 Autumn Gauntlet: European and Domestic Cup Hurdles

Beyond the immediate Premier League horizon, the late September and October schedule introduces the Carabao Cup third round and the meat of the European group stages. The 2026/27 Champions League draw, scheduled for late August, will determine the travel burden the squad must endure during their midweek shifts. Arsenal’s return to elite European status has made their Tuesday and Wednesday nights a permanent fixture of the footballing calendar once again.

The depth of the squad will be tested when the FA Cup third-round fixtures are announced in December, but the immediate focus remains on the "Autumn Gauntlet." History shows that teams leading the table by the October international break have a 65% higher probability of finishing in the top two. For Arteta’s men, the upcoming matches against top-tier opposition are not just about points; they are about establishing psychological dominance in a league that has become increasingly competitive at the summit.
